Understanding Implied Volatility
Implied volatility reflects the market’s expectations for future price swings. When options exhibit elevated implied volatility, it signals that traders anticipate substantial movement—either upward or downward—in the underlying stock. This heightened volatility may also suggest that a major event is on the horizon, potentially leading to sharp gains or losses. However, implied volatility is just one factor to consider when crafting an options trading plan.
Analyst Sentiment and Market Outlook
Options traders are clearly bracing for a significant price shift in Acadia Healthcare (ACHC+4.70%). But what do analysts say about the company’s fundamentals? At present, Acadia Healthcare holds a Zacks Rank #4 (Sell) within the Medical – Hospital sector, which itself ranks in the top 36% of all Zacks industry groups. Over the past two months, one analyst has raised their earnings forecast for the current quarter, while two have lowered theirs. As a result, the Zacks Consensus Estimate for quarterly earnings has slipped from 29 cents per share to 28 cents.
Given this mixed analyst outlook, the surge in implied volatility could signal a trading opportunity. Many experienced options traders seek out contracts with high implied volatility to sell premium, aiming to benefit from time decay. Their strategy relies on the hope that the stock’s actual movement will be less dramatic than what the market has priced in by expiration.
